SUSE CVE-2025-39826

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: net: rose: convert 'use' field to refcountt The 'use' field in struct roseneigh is used as a reference counter but lacks atomicity. This can lead to race conditions where a roseneigh structure is freed while still being reference...

CVE-2023-51782

The CVE-2023-51782 issue affects the Linux kernel (net/rose/af_rose.c) and is a use-after-free in rose_ioctl caused by a race in rose_accept. Affected versions are before 6.6.8. The vulnerability can lead to local privilege escalation or kernel crash. Mitigation: upgrade to Linux kernel 6.6.8 or ...
